One of the primary challenges lies in the sheer complexity of synthesizing information from various
perspectives. Combining ideas, arguments, and evidence from different sources while maintaining
coherence and relevance is an intricate dance. The process requires a keen understanding of the topic
and a sharp analytical mind to extract meaningful connections.
Researching for a synthesis essay thesis adds another layer of difficulty. Sorting through vast
amounts of information to find the most relevant and credible sources is a time-consuming task.
Additionally, evaluating the reliability and validity of each source demands a discerning eye to
ensure the foundation of the thesis is solid.
